About this item

  • Highest shock load rating to date being able to withstand the power of the 400hp machines
  • Latest bottom cog design for greater rotational efficiency at full shift
  • Aramid Fiber cord, versus polyester, wraps over bottom cogs for increased bottom cog strength


This belt is for the rider / racer that is looking for the ultimate in belt technology and proven performance. This belt acts like the OEM belt in terms of engagement and operating RPMs. Race Proven Performance.

Replaces OEM PN’s 422280651 / 422280652 for the Maverick X3, Maverick Sport, Maverick Trail and Defender models.

Compatible with the following vehicles:

  • 2017-2021 Maverick X3 (inc. Max and Turbo)
  • 2018-2020 Maverick X3 900
  • 2018-2021 Maverick Sport 1000
  • 2018-2021 Maverick Trail 1000 / 800
  • 2016-2021 Defender 1000 / 800

This is the top rated belt and I can certainly see why. To start off, clutch engagement is super smooth, no more clunking at low rpm engagement. It seems the disconnect between those that love or hate this belt is whether you believe in breaking in your belt. Basic break in procedure driving in low range and drive 15-25 mph for 20 min, let it cool completely, repeat the process, cool once more and your belt should be broken in. Low range is so you can get as many belt revolutions as possible without placing much load, or building any heat. People that break in claim multiple thousands of miles, whereas others claim this is garbage and breaks in 100 miles. Hope this helps.
